Local tips

  • For a more intimate experience, book one of Viansa's Sonoma Experiences ahead of time for guided food and wine pairings.
  • Visit on a clear day to witness the unique virtues of Viansa's land stewardship, with over 500 species of birds calling the coastal wetlands home.
  • Check out the marketplace for Sonoma-specific souvenirs and stylish wine merchandise.
  • Walk-in groups of 5 or less are welcome for bar tastings; reservations are required for larger groups.

Getting There

  • Driving

    Viansa Winery is located at 25200 Arnold Dr, Sonoma, CA 95476, just off Highway 121. From Sonoma Plaza, head southeast on E Napa St toward 1st St E. Continue onto Arnold Dr/CA-121 S for approximately 6 miles. The winery will be on your left. There is ample on-site parking available. Parking is free.

  • Taxi/Rideshare

    From Sonoma Plaza, a taxi or rideshare to Viansa Winery will take approximately 10-15 minutes. Taxi/rideshare services are available in Sonoma, including Uber and Lyft. The typical cost for a one-way trip from Sonoma Plaza to Viansa Winery ranges from $16 to $27, depending on the service and time of day.

Discover more about Viansa Winery

Viansa Winery, idyllically situated at the summit of Sonoma Valley, provides a unique blend of Northern Italian winemaking traditions and the rich environment of Sonoma Valley. Founded in 1989 by Samuele Sebastiani's grandson, Viansa carries a legacy dating back to 1896, when Samuele arrived from Tuscany. He saved enough money making cobblestones for San Francisco streets to purchase vineyard property in 1904. The winery encompasses 33 acres of vineyards and 97 acres of wetlands, showcasing a commitment to both winemaking and environmental stewardship. Guests can enjoy award-winning, all-Californian wines, including oaky reds like Zinfandel and Cabernet Sauvignon, and lightly acidic whites like Chardonnay. The winery also offers a marketplace with Sonoma-specific souvenirs and stylish wine merchandise. Viansa's architecture evokes a Tuscan villa, complete with a welcoming courtyard and panoramic views of the Sonoma Valley. Visitors can explore the underground barrel-aging cellar adorned with hand-painted murals. The winery is a popular location for weddings and events, offering full-service coordination and customizable packages. Viansa provides a memorable wine country experience with its stunning views, Italian heritage, and dedication to quality.
